Hermes Belt Real Price: Deconstructing the Cost

The starting price for a genuine Hermès belt with silver hardware generally sits around $1,925.00 USD. However, this is merely a baseline. The actual price can escalate dramatically depending on several key factors:

* Leather Type: The type of leather used significantly impacts the price. Exquisite leathers like Togo, Clemence, Epsom, and Swift command higher prices due to their durability, texture, and rarity. Togo, known for its pebbled texture and scratch resistance, is a popular choice, while Clemence offers a softer, more supple feel. Epsom is prized for its smooth, structured appearance, and Swift is a softer, more luxurious option. The rarity and desirability of certain leather finishes further influence pricing.

* Hardware: While we are focusing on silver hardware, the specific type of silver plating or the presence of precious metals incorporated into the buckle design (e.g., palladium, gold accents) will affect the price. A simple silver buckle will be less expensive than one with intricate detailing or a combination of metals. The weight of the buckle itself also plays a role.

* Belt Width: Hermès belts come in various widths, typically ranging from 1.5 cm to 4 cm. Wider belts generally command higher prices due to the increased amount of leather required.

* Buckle Design: The buckle itself is a major determinant of price. The iconic Hermès "H" buckle is a classic, but variations in design, size, and embellishments can significantly impact the cost. More elaborate buckles with intricate engravings or precious metal inlays will be considerably more expensive.

* Condition: The condition of a pre-owned Hermès belt is crucial. A pristine, unworn belt will fetch a higher price than one showing signs of wear and tear. Authenticity verification is paramount when purchasing a pre-owned belt.

* Retailer: Purchasing from an authorized Hermès retailer will guarantee authenticity, but prices may be slightly higher compared to reputable resale markets. However, the peace of mind and warranty offered by authorized retailers are significant considerations.
